    I have a 2TB Time Capsule (Model No. A1409).  I think that it is approximately 20 months old.  It has been working very well until around two months ago, when it began to display the flashing amber light.  At that time I performed a hard reset, restoring the default settings.  This worked and the capsule continued backing up perfectly for a further three weeks.  However, about three weeks back the flashing amber light returned.  As I have been busy elsewhere I was not able to attend to this untl recently.  It does not seem to matter how many times I reset the device, I cannot return it to a working state.
    The capsule has previously been set up to connect to the internet through my existing broadband service.  As such, it was initially set up and subsequently restored wirelessly.  I no longer seem to be able to achieve this.  Has anybody else experienced similar difficulties and if so, were you able to remedy it.
    Grateful for any advice.  I feel another trip to the Genius Bar coming on.

    Yeah absolutely - no problem.
    I had the same thing happen where I did a restore on my personal TimeCapsule (TC),
    and when I updated the device after installing it, it for some reason set the TC into bridged mode shutting off DHCP/NAT service.
    Which means, that it doesn't reserve an IP for any client trying to attach. This is what it sounds like yours is doing.
    So if you see that it says bridged, and that box with dhcp reservation is greyed out, change it from bridged to DHCP/NAT.
    This will allow any client (computer/device) to attach and reserve an IP address for access to the internet.
    Once that is set, and you update, hopefully the light should go green.
    I would also recommend checking the "internet" tab, and making sure that your IP address is assigned using DHCP. (It probably is - but that part is essential for communication with your Internet Service Provider (ISP)...
    SO - if the device goes green after the update:
    If it does, then go back into the router and click on the wireless tab and confirm your wireless settings are correct, if any changes are made, update.
    At that point, you should be able unplug your laptop to wirelessly connect to the router.

  • Virtual WIFI Stopped Working - Restore Default Settings?

    I use the virtual WIFI function in Windows 7 (via Connectify) to create a hotspot in my hotel rooms for my Iphone.  Two days ago, the virtual WIFI connection stopped giving any Router or DNS information to my phone.  It gets an ip and subnet, but
    nothing else.  I don't recall what IP's I used to get, but the current ip is not in the 192.168.x.x range.
    Ive tried removing the wireless card from the hardware list and letting windows reinstall it. I've also updated my driver (although it was working fine with the previous driver.)  I also tried using an AdHoc setup.  No solution so far.
    I did have a software update for MagicJack happen during the time the issue began.  I spoke with MagicJack support - they insist it isn't their issue.
    Any thoughts?
    Richard

    Hi Richard,
    Did you receive any error message? What IP address it got?
    Since the issue occurred after updating the MagicJack, I suggest performing a
    System Restore to check
    if it can resolve the issue.
    If the issue persists, you can use the following commands to reset the virtual WIFI.
    To start the wireless Hosted Network.
    netsh wlan start hostednetwork             
    To stop the wireless Hosted Network.
    netsh wlan stop hostednetwork              
    To enable or disable the wireless Hosted Network.
    netsh wlan set hostednetwork [mode=]allow|disallow
    For more information, you can refer to the following article.
    http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/dd815243(v=vs.85).aspx
